I have been looking through my subscriptions, and it seems I have a lot of magazine subscriptions which is a lot of material to peruse. Some are good, some are bad, some I am indifferent, but it seems to depend on the issue.
Personally, I currently subscribe to WoodSmith, Shopnotes (just started back), Wood magazine, Fine Woodworking, and Wood magazine.
I like Woodsmith a lot. I don't necessarily use their methodology every time, but I like their dimensions and their projects.
Shopnotes is hit or miss. Some stuff good, some I really don't care about.
Fine Woodworking is top of the line. A lot of the stuff in their is out of my realm, but I get ideas and learn a lot. For example, I recently went through back issues and got a lot of insight in upgrading my bandsaw from 5 different issues.
Wood seems to be so so. They have done more on routers and router tables than I would ever believe. Some nice projects, but I am not sure if I will renew it or not.
